黑狐家游戏

比较常用的关系数据库有,目前比较常用的是关系型数据库

欧气 2 0

本文目录导读:

  1. 关系型数据库简介
  2. 常用的关系型数据库
  3. 关系型数据库的优势
  4. 关系型数据库在不同领域的应用

《关系型数据库:现代数据管理的常用利器》

在当今数字化的时代,数据的管理和存储是各个领域至关重要的任务,关系型数据库作为目前比较常用的数据库类型,在众多应用场景中发挥着不可替代的作用。

关系型数据库简介

关系型数据库是建立在关系模型基础上的数据库,它通过表格(关系)来存储数据,这些表格由行(记录)和列(字段)组成,一个简单的员工信息表可能包含员工编号、姓名、年龄、部门等列,每一行则代表一个具体的员工信息,关系型数据库的核心概念包括实体(如员工就是一个实体)、属性(姓名、年龄等就是员工实体的属性)和关系(如员工与部门之间存在所属关系)。

常用的关系型数据库

1、MySQL

比较常用的关系数据库有,目前比较常用的是关系型数据库

图片来源于网络,如有侵权联系删除

- MySQL是一个开源的关系型数据库管理系统,具有广泛的用户基础,它以其易用性、高性能和可靠性而受到青睐,对于小型企业和创业公司来说,MySQL是构建网站、Web应用程序后端数据存储的理想选择,许多内容管理系统(CMS),如WordPress,默认支持MySQL作为数据库,它支持多种操作系统,包括Linux、Windows等,并且有丰富的文档和社区支持,开发人员可以轻松地使用SQL(结构化查询语言)来创建、查询、更新和删除数据库中的数据。

- 在高并发的Web应用场景下,MySQL通过优化查询缓存、索引等机制来提高性能,对于一个电商网站,大量的商品信息、用户订单信息等都可以高效地存储在MySQL数据库中,通过合理地设计数据库架构,如创建合适的索引(根据商品的类别、用户的ID等创建索引),可以大大提高查询速度,减少响应时间。

2、Oracle Database

- Oracle Database是一款功能强大的商业关系型数据库,它在大型企业级应用中占据重要地位,Oracle提供了高度的安全性、可扩展性和可靠性,在金融、电信等对数据安全和稳定性要求极高的行业中被广泛应用,它支持复杂的事务处理,能够处理海量的数据。

- 在银行系统中,每天有大量的资金转账、账户查询等事务操作,Oracle Database能够确保这些事务的一致性和完整性,它具有先进的备份和恢复机制,即使在出现硬件故障或人为错误的情况下,也能够快速恢复数据,Oracle的数据库管理工具非常强大,数据库管理员可以方便地进行性能监控、调优和安全管理等操作。

3、SQL Server

- SQL Server是微软公司推出的关系型数据库管理系统,它与Windows操作系统紧密集成,对于使用微软技术栈的企业来说是一个很好的选择,SQL Server提供了丰富的功能,如数据挖掘、商业智能等。

- 在企业内部的管理信息系统(MIS)中,SQL Server可以存储和管理各种业务数据,如员工考勤数据、销售数据等,它的开发工具,如SQL Server Management Studio,使得开发人员和数据库管理员能够方便地进行数据库的开发、部署和管理,SQL Server在数据加密、身份验证等方面也有很好的表现,能够满足企业对数据安全的需求。

比较常用的关系数据库有,目前比较常用的是关系型数据库

图片来源于网络,如有侵权联系删除

关系型数据库的优势

1、数据一致性和完整性

- 关系型数据库通过定义约束(如主键约束、外键约束、唯一约束等)来确保数据的一致性和完整性,在一个包含订单表和客户表的数据库中,订单表中的客户ID作为外键与客户表中的主键相关联,这样可以确保订单中引用的客户ID是有效的,避免了数据的不一致性。

2、结构化查询语言(SQL)的通用性

- SQL是关系型数据库的标准查询语言,开发人员可以使用SQL在不同的关系型数据库中进行数据操作,这使得开发人员能够轻松地在不同的项目和数据库环境之间切换,一个熟悉MySQL中SQL用法的开发人员,在学习和使用Oracle Database时,能够较快地适应,因为SQL的基本语法和操作(如SELECT、INSERT、UPDATE、DELETE等语句)在不同的关系型数据库中是相似的。

3、事务处理能力

- 关系型数据库支持事务处理,事务具有原子性、一致性、隔离性和持久性(ACID)特性,在多用户并发访问数据库的情况下,这些特性能够确保数据的正确性,在一个航空订票系统中,当多个用户同时预订同一航班的机票时,关系型数据库的事务处理机制能够确保不会出现超额预订等错误情况。

关系型数据库在不同领域的应用

1、电子商务领域

- 在电子商务平台中,关系型数据库用于存储海量的商品信息、用户信息、订单信息等,商品信息可能包括商品名称、价格、库存数量等字段,用户信息则包含用户名、密码、收货地址等,订单信息涉及订单编号、下单时间、商品列表、用户ID等,通过关系型数据库的关联查询功能,可以方便地查询某个用户的订单历史、某个商品的销售情况等。

比较常用的关系数据库有,目前比较常用的是关系型数据库

图片来源于网络,如有侵权联系删除

2、金融领域

- 银行、证券等金融机构依靠关系型数据库来管理客户账户信息、交易记录等,客户账户信息包括账户余额、账户类型等重要数据,每一笔交易记录都需要准确无误地存储在数据库中,关系型数据库的高可靠性和数据完整性保证机制在这里发挥着关键作用,金融机构还可以利用关系型数据库进行风险评估,例如通过分析客户的交易历史、资产状况等数据来评估信用风险。

3、医疗领域

- 医院的信息管理系统使用关系型数据库存储患者的基本信息(如姓名、年龄、性别等)、病历信息(如疾病诊断、治疗过程等)以及医疗资源信息(如药品库存、医疗器械信息等),医生可以通过查询关系型数据库快速获取患者的病史等重要信息,以便做出准确的诊断和治疗方案。

关系型数据库以其成熟的理论基础、强大的功能和广泛的适用性,在现代数据管理领域占据着主导地位,虽然随着大数据和云计算等技术的发展,非关系型数据库也逐渐兴起,但关系型数据库仍然是众多企业和开发者的首选,并且在不断发展和演进以适应新的需求。

标签: #关系数据库 #常用 #关系型 #数据库

黑狐家游戏
  • 评论列表

留言评论